
Install and configure Apache NiFi on Linux by downloading the latest release, unzip, set web properties IP and port, create a single user, start NiFi, and log in.
Navigate the NiFi UI canvas to explore processors, ports, and process groups, use the search bar and palettes to troubleshoot, enable or disable components, and manage data flow.
Answer a five-question NiFi quiz covering convert record, Avro to Json, and Json to Avro conversions, plus insert and update sql statements.
Explore flow versioning with NiFi registry, linking buckets to process groups, committing changes, and creating templates to reuse data flows across environments.
Answer seven questions on data provenance in Apache NiFi, covering event types, provenance and content repositories, data lineage, replay effects, and related reporting tasks.
Learn how back pressure and thresholds regulate flow in Apache NiFi, using queue objects and data size limits, and how back pressure prediction estimates timing with NiFi analytics.
Master flow file prioritization in Apache NiFi by managing queue back pressure, expiration, and aging, using first in, first out, newest first, oldest first, priority attributes, and enforce order.
Cover SSL/TLS configuration for Apache Nifi, enabling client certificate authentication and using the TLS toolkit to generate trust stores, keystores, and client or server certificates.
Learn to configure authentication and authorization in Apache NiFi by setting keystore and truststore, adjusting NiFi security properties, and enabling multi-user access through a managed authorizer and access policies.
Master Apache NiFi by using the user interface and configuring data flows, ingesting, transforming, and enriching data into the database, with templates, auditing, troubleshooting, and best practices.
Become an Apache Nifi professional and learn one of employer's most requested skills nowadays!
This comprehensive course is designed so that Data Engineers and Developers, System Administrators, Data Analysts, IT Professionals... can learn Apache Nifi from scratch to use it in a practical and professional way. Never mind if you have no experience in the topic, you will be equally capable of understanding everything and you will finish the course with total mastery of the subject.
After several years working in Data Management, we have realized that nowadays mastering Apache Nifi for data flow automation is very necessary in Big Data and Analytics, IoT (Internet of Things) and various other fields due to its versatility. Knowing how to use this tool can give you many job opportunities and many economic benefits, especially in the world of data management automation.
The big problem has always been the complexity to perfectly understand Nifi requires, since its absolute mastery is not easy. In this course we try to facilitate this entire learning and improvement process, so that you will be able to carry out and understand your own projects in a short time, thanks to the step-by-step, detailed and hands-on examples of every concept.
With almost 10 exclusive hours of video and 33 lectures, this comprehensive course leaves no stone unturned! It includes both practical exercises and theoretical examples to master Apache Nifi. The course will teach you how to automate data flow management, including ingestion, transformation, routing, and real-time processing in a practical way, from scratch, and step by step.
We will start with the setup of the needed work environment on your computer, regardless of your operating system and computer.
Then, we'll cover a wide variety of topics, including:
Introduction to Apache Nifi and course dynamics
Understanding of Apache NiFi and successfully set it up
Navigate, create, and configure data flows using processors and connections
Explore ingesting data from various sources and performing transformations
Monitor, manage data flows, and implement versioning strategies
Track data lineage, audit, and troubleshoot effectively
Implement back pressure, prioritize flow file processing efficiently
Utilize cache values and construct effective process groups
Optimize performance and apply best practices in data flow design
Configure security measures and explore NiFi's broader ecosystem including related projects like NiFi Registry and MiNiFi
Apply learned concepts to practical data integration scenarios
Mastery and application of absolutely ALL the functionalities of Apache Nifi
Practical exercises, quizes, complete projects and much more!
In other words, what we want is to contribute our grain of sand and teach you all those things that we would have liked to know in our beginnings and that nobody explained to us. In this way, you can learn to build and manage a wide variety of projects and make versatile and complete use of Nifi. And if that were not enough, you will get lifetime access to any class and we will be at your disposal to answer all the questions you want in the shortest possible time.
Learning Apache Nifi has never been easier. What are you waiting to join?